The switching process

Switching your mortgage is simple. No credit checks. No underwriting. You can do it online in around 10 minutes once you’ve found the mortgage that suits you. You can also give us a call if you want to discuss your options. You'll get personal service, with one single point of contact through the whole mortgage process.

You can switch your mortgage within the last three months of your current rate. If you find a rate you would like to switch to, you must select it at least ten days before your current one ends. If you don’t, you will be moved to our Standard Variable Rate for a minimum of one month.

Overpayments

You can make one-off and regular overpayments at any time in addition to your normal monthly payments.

Making overpayments could save you paying a considerable amount of interest, and may also help you to repay your mortgage earlier.

How much can I overpay by?

Each year residential mortgage customers can overpay by up to 20% and Buy to Let customers up to 10% of their original advance. This resets on the anniversary of when your mortgage started.

If you overpay by more than this, early repayment charges are applied - you’ll have all the details about this in your mortgage offer paperwork.

What happens when I make an overpayment?

Any payment of less than £500 will be kept as a credit on your mortgage, and will not reduce your mortgage balance, unless it means you have a total credit of £500 or more.

If you make a payment that means you will be £500 or more in credit, we will automatically reduce your mortgage balance. We’ll recalculate your monthly payments in line with your new mortgage balance.

It isn’t possible to under pay your mortgage or to take payment holidays.

Later life mortgages

We’ve partnered with Legal & General to offer you lifetime and retirement interest only mortgages.

Designed for customers aged 55 or over, a later life mortgage lets you borrow money based on the value of your home, as a loan secured against it, while you continue to live there. The loan is usually repaid when the last surviving borrower dies or moves out of the home into long-term care.

  • With a lifetime mortgage you are able to decide whether you’d like to pay all, some or none of the interest each month.  
  • With a retirement interest only mortgage you must pay the interest in full each month. As a last resort, your home may be repossessed if you do not keep up with your payments.

There’s lots to consider so it’s important to receive financial advice to help you make the right decision. There may be cheaper ways to borrow money. Legal & General has its own team of specialist later life mortgage advisers, to help you find the right option for you. If you speak to one of their advisers, there’s no obligation to proceed.
